Basics of cardiopulmonary bypass

open access: yesIndian Journal of Anaesthesia, 2017
Cardiopulmonary bypass (CPB) provides a bloodless field for cardiac surgery. It incorporates an extracorporeal circuit to provide physiological support in which venous blood is drained to a reservoir, oxygenated and sent back to the body using a pump ...
